前言:为什么需要SOCKS5代理?
在开始动手前,我们先花一分钟了解它能帮你做什么。简单来说,SOCKS5代理就像给你的网络连接套上一个“虚拟定位器”和“隐身衣”。
- 更换网络身份:让网站或应用认为你来自代理服务器所在的地区(例如,使用一个上海的IP,让平台以为你在上海)。
- 保护隐私:隐藏你的真实IP地址,增加一层网络匿名性。
- 兼容性强:不同于只针对网页浏览的HTTP代理,SOCKS5协议几乎能转发所有类型的网络数据,包括游戏、下载、社交软件等,因此被称为更“全能”的转发工具。
第一步:准备工作——找到你的“通行证”
配置代理就像连接Wi-Fi,你需要先获得正确的账户信息。这些信息通常从你购买的代理服务商后台获取。
- 选择服务商:你可以选择历史对话中提到的天行IP、四叶天、芝麻代理等,或者其他任何提供SOCKS5服务的平台。
- 获取关键信息:购买服务后,在服务商后台找到你的SOCKS5代理信息,通常包括:
- 服务器地址/代理IP:一串数字(如
123.45.67.89)或一个网址。 - 端口:通常是4-5位数字(如
1080,30001)。 - 用户名:如果需要认证的话。
- 密码:如果需要认证的话。
- 协议:确保选择 SOCKS5。
- 服务器地址/代理IP:一串数字(如
小贴士:建议将这些信息复制到记事本中,配置时直接粘贴,避免手动输入错误。
第二步:选择你的配置场景
根据你想让哪些应用走代理,选择对应的配置方法:
flowchart TD
A[开始配置SOCKS5代理] --> B{你想让谁走代理?}
B --> C[整台电脑<br>(所有软件)]
B --> D[仅浏览器]
B --> E[特定软件/爬虫]
B --> F[防关联多账号运营]
C --> C1[Windows/Mac系统设置]
D --> D1[浏览器插件或设置]
E --> E1[软件内设置或代码配置]
F --> F1[指纹浏览器配置]
C1 --> G[完成配置,测试验证]
D1 --> G
E1 --> G
F1 --> G
场景一:为整台Windows电脑设置代理(全局代理)
适合希望所有联网程序都通过代理访问网络的用户。
- 打开设置:点击开始菜单 -> 选择“设置”(齿轮图标)。
- 进入网络设置:选择“网络和Internet” -> 点击左侧的“代理”。
- 启用手动设置:
- 在“手动设置代理”部分,将“使用代理服务器”的开关拨到开。
- 在“地址”栏填入你的代理服务器地址。
- 在“端口”栏填入你的端口号。
- 处理认证:如果服务商提供了用户名和密码,系统可能会弹出窗口让你输入,请正确填写。
- 保存:点击“保存”,配置即刻生效。
验证方法:打开浏览器,访问 ip.sb 或 ipinfo.io,显示的IP地址和地理位置应该已变为你的代理IP信息。
场景二:仅让浏览器走代理
如果你只想在浏览网页时使用代理,不影响其他软件(如微信、Steam),这是最灵活的方式。
对于Chrome/Edge浏览器(推荐使用插件):
- 安装插件:在Chrome网上应用店搜索并安装 SwitchyOmega 插件。
- 配置代理:
- 点击浏览器右上角的插件图标,选择“选项”。
- 点击“新建情景模式”,取名(如“我的代理”),类型选“代理服务器”。
- 在代理协议中选择 SOCKS5,并填入服务器地址和端口。
- 如果需要认证,填写用户名和密码。
- 点击“应用选项”保存。
- 切换使用:以后需要代理时,只需点击浏览器右上角的SwitchyOmega图标,选择你创建的代理模式即可。
对于Firefox浏览器(原生支持):
- 打开Firefox“设置” -> 搜索或找到“网络设置”。
- 点击“设置…”按钮,进入连接设置。
- 选择“手动代理配置”,在“SOCKS主机”栏填入地址和端口,并选择 SOCKS v5。
- 强烈建议勾选“代理DNS查询”,以防止DNS泄露真实位置。
- 点击“确定”保存。
场景三:在指纹浏览器中配置(防关联必备)
这是进行跨境电商、社媒多账号运营等防关联业务的首选方法,能为每个账号绑定独立的IP和浏览器环境。以AdsPower为例:
- 创建环境:打开AdsPower,点击“新建浏览器配置文件”。
- 配置代理:在“代理配置”区域,选择“自定义代理”。
- 代理类型选择 SOCKS5。
- 依次填入 代理主机(IP)、端口、用户名、密码。
- 测试连接:点击“检查代理”按钮,确保显示“连接成功”。
- 保存并启动:保存配置后,启动该浏览器环境。在这个窗口内登录的所有账号都将通过你配置的独立SOCKS5代理IP进行访问,实现完美隔离。
场景四:在编程或爬虫中使用
如果你需要通过写代码来使用代理,也非常简单。
Python示例(使用requests库):
import requests
# 你的SOCKS5代理信息
proxy_ip = "你的代理服务器地址"
proxy_port = "你的端口"
username = "你的用户名" # 如果没有,留空或删除这行
password = "你的密码" # 如果没有,留空或删除这行
# 组装代理地址
proxy_url = f"socks5://{username}:{password}@{proxy_ip}:{proxy_port}"
proxies = {
"http": proxy_url,
"https": proxy_url
}
# 发起一个请求测试
try:
response = requests.get("https://httpbin.org/ip", proxies=proxies, timeout=10)
print("代理IP是:", response.json())
except Exception as e:
print("连接失败:", e)
这段代码会将你的网络请求通过SOCKS5代理发送出去。
第四步:常见问题与排查(新手必看)
配置后遇到问题?别慌,按这个清单一步步检查:
| 问题症状 | 可能原因 | 解决步骤 |
|---|---|---|
| 完全无法上网 | 1. 代理信息填写错误 2. 本地网络不通 3. 代理服务器失效 |
1. 仔细核对IP、端口、用户名、密码,一个字符都不能错。 2. 关闭代理,测试本地网络是否正常。 3. 联系代理服务商客服确认IP状态。 |
| 网速变得非常慢 | 1. 代理服务器负载高或带宽小 2. 服务器距离你太远 |
1. 尝试更换另一个代理IP或节点。 2. 选择离你物理位置更近的节点(例如,你在国内,优先选国内节点)。 |
| 某些网站打不开 | 该代理IP已被目标网站封禁 | 更换一个新的、纯净的(特别是住宅)代理IP再试。 |
| 显示代理已连接,但IP没变 | 1. 配置未生效 2. 软件未正确调用代理 |
1. 重启浏览器或相关软件。 2. 确认你是在已配置代理的浏览器环境或软件中访问IP查询网站。 |
总结与安全提醒
恭喜你!至此,你已经掌握了在不同场景下配置SOCKS5代理的核心技能。记住几个关键点:
- 信息准确是前提:确保从可靠服务商获取的信息正确无误。
- 场景匹配是关键:根据需要选择全局、浏览器单独或指纹浏览器配置。
- 验证生效是必须:配置后务必用IP查询网站检查是否成功。
- 安全合法使用:请遵守法律法规和服务商条款,将代理技术用于正当用途。
代理工具是扩展网络能力的重要手段,希望这篇指南能帮你轻松上手,畅游网络世界。
全网低价IP-国内外IP源头渠道(socks5ip.com.cn)
支持无双IP(海外)、奔富IP、天行IP、沧海IP、光子IP、天机IP、优享云IP、鲸云IP、糖果IP等数十个国内外知名IP平台
自助提货,100%独享,免费测试,支持续费和调换
有任何IP使用问题,或量大谈合作,请点击【添加微信】,诚招代理!


评论0